Diversity Work Team Project
Students solve an existing industry problem (modified for team competition)
as members of a diverse team. Each five-member team includes freshmen from populations
underrepresented in engineering and the physical sciences as well as students
from the general population.
Each team draws on the its members' individual strengths to solve specific
problems. Students develop team skills and the leadership skills they need to
be productive members in a diverse workplace. The project also gives students
the skills and experience that prepare them for immediate placement within a
corporate work setting: consensus building, decision making, conflict resolution,
and project planning.
Teams will be assigned a corporate coach for the team competition and each
team will receive $500 per team member plus an allowance for team support.
